Through the lineup, the Steering Shaft connects the wheel to the steering gearbox by a solid but collapsible column designed to endure road shock and still cushion the crash energy to safe and stable handling. A middle Steering Shaft part addresses the change of angles between the cabin and the chassis and prevents the clunks even before they occur. High-grade steel is applied in lower joints and splines are very accurate to allow torque to flow smoothly and hence the highway grooves do not give any vague on-center feel. Once the Steering Shaft wears, you will sense the heaviness and hear some knocks, and that is the time to take action.
